Never ascribe to malice that which can be adequately explained by stupidity. The TLDR; ... If you care to listen this is my interpretation, some poor developer on a deadline was given a task to make x work. They did so by making x work, some mgr or other above didnt a) review it enough, b) express the requirements (hippa) well enough to poor dev or to architect, etc... Dev used some third party open source (probably approved under corporate policy) to do x, this bringing in the line of code. So, failure on the dev, maybe. Failure on the architect probably (esp regarding data protection). Failure on CMS, failure on the contractor. All of the above. Failure on the politicians for taking a line and blowing it out of proportions and to save face. Who gets blamed?...Poor joe/jane developer or their manager. Its the corporations and the politicians who are toxic...
